On the Today View screen is it impossible to put the Apple widgets below normal app widgets? I want the batteries widget but I don’t want it pushing the other stuff down to where I have to scroll to see it
|
# ? Sep 17, 2020 20:34 |
|
Snowy posted:On the Today View screen is it impossible to put the Apple widgets below normal app widgets? if an app hasn't updated its widgets for ios 14 they get relegated to the customize zone. you can arrange third-party and apple widgets among each other freely as long as the third-party widgets have been updated
